Role Description Seeking a highly skilled and experienced Senior Personal Lines Underwriter to join a team. This role involves underwriting homeowner property and umbrella lines, with a focus on multi-family properties such as condos, rentals, and combination dwellings. The ideal candidate will have a strong background in underwriting, excellent relationship-building skills with independent agents, and a collaborative, team-oriented mindset. Qualifications - Minimum of 8 years of experience underwriting homeowner property and umbrella lines. - Proven experience underwriting multi-family properties, including condos, rentals, and combination dwellings (up to 4 units). - Expertise in underwriting homeowner property in PA and NJ. - Strong relationships with independent agents are highly desirable. - Experience with Guidewire software is a plus. - Background in a regional insurance carrier is preferred over large carriers. - Team-oriented with a positive attitude and strong interpersonal skills. Requirements - Review policies with significant losses prior to renewal. - Assess risk changes to ensure eligibility and accurate rating for upcoming term renewals. - Evaluate files processed through automated rules for accuracy. - Collaborate with Business Development Specialists to drive profitable growth with existing and new agents. - Partner with Loss Control Specialists on home inspections, loss mitigation requests, and Insurance-to-Value (ITV) matters. - Work with the Underwriting Tech team to process policy transactions efficiently. - Perform job duties independently and as part of a team. - Provide support to team members as needed. - Travel occasionally to meet with agents and maintain strong working relationships.
